Cash, Joseph Harper was born on January 3, 1927 in Mitchell, South Dakota, United States. Son of Joseph R. and Claudia B. (Harper) Cash.
Bachelor, University South Dakota, 1949. Master of Arts, 1959. Doctor of Philosophy, University Iowa, 1966.
Teacher public schools, South Dakota, 1951-1962. Instructor Black Hills State College, summer 1961. Graduate assistant University Iowa, 1962-1965.
Associate professor history Eastern Montana College, 1965-1968. Research associate Institute Indian Studies University South Dakota, summer 1967, 68, director institute division Indian research, 1970-1977, acting director institute, 1976-1977, 86-87, associate professor, 1970-1974, Duke research professor history, since 1972, professor, since 1974, dean College Arts and Sciences, 1977-1987. Director American Indian Research Project, State of South Dakota, 1969-1974, South Dakota Oral History Project, 1970-1974, Oral History Center (merger both projects), 1974-1977.
Chairman South Dakota Board History Preservation, 1970-1973. Chairman council directors, cultural president division State South Dakota, 1975-1976. Member South Dakota Council on Humanities, 1975-1977, South Dakota History Records Advisory Board, 1976-1986, South Dakota Board Cultural Preservation, since 1977, Kampgrounds of America-U. Member South Dakota Centennial Commission, since 1986. Served with United States Marine Corps Reserve, 1945-1946. Member American History Association, Oral History Association, Organization American Historians, South Dakota History Society (president since 1977), Western History Association, Phi Beta Kappa, Phi Delta Theta.
Married Margaret Ann Halla, December 18, 1952. Children– Sheridan Lisa, Joseph Mark, Meredith Annual.
